Reclaim Your Time: Streamlining Tasks in Your Online Business
Welcome to episode 11 of the “Productive Entrepreneur Podcast,” where we focus on streamlining tasks to elevate your business efficiency.
In today’s episode, we’re diving into some powerful strategies: from leveraging automation tools and embracing outsourcing to the practicality of batching work and the importance of creating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s). These insights are all about helping you reclaim your time and focus on what truly matters in your business. Discover how simplifying and organizing tasks can lead to greater customer satisfaction and business growth.
